06-23-2007, 12:28 PM
Took these while I was away too in a little place called Lochinver, a fairly busy fishing port. In the trees at the back of the port were about 30 Heron nests. We could see this one quite easily from the path below without disturbing them - a few young ones poked their heads out and stretched their wings from time to time but they hadn't yet started flying. A couple of adults were circling around from time to time and landing on the tops of the trees - how such a big bird can land on a tiny branch without it even swaying I don't know. The tourist info centre had a camera near one of the nests too so you could go in and see them close up.

shoney
01-08-2008, 03:04 AM
A pukeko in my garden eating bread, they stand a couple of feet high , this pic doesn't do it justice as the purpley/blue and black of its plumage hasn't come out on the picture, they are a pretty dumb bird and will watch your car approach before stepping out right in front of it, the maori's used to eat them but their meat is pretty tough
